版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報或認(rèn)領(lǐng)
文檔簡介
數(shù)據(jù)結(jié)構(gòu)第二章課件XX有限公司20XX匯報人:XX目錄01基本概念介紹02線性結(jié)構(gòu)03非線性結(jié)構(gòu)04算法基礎(chǔ)05排序算法06查找算法基本概念介紹01數(shù)據(jù)結(jié)構(gòu)定義核心要素邏輯結(jié)構(gòu)、物理結(jié)構(gòu)定義概述數(shù)據(jù)組織、存儲方式0102數(shù)據(jù)結(jié)構(gòu)分類數(shù)組、鏈表等,數(shù)據(jù)元素間存在一對一關(guān)系。線性結(jié)構(gòu)樹、圖等,數(shù)據(jù)元素間存在一對多或多對多關(guān)系。非線性結(jié)構(gòu)數(shù)據(jù)結(jié)構(gòu)重要性數(shù)據(jù)結(jié)構(gòu)是算法實現(xiàn)的基礎(chǔ),對程序效率至關(guān)重要?;A(chǔ)支撐合理的數(shù)據(jù)結(jié)構(gòu)能顯著提升程序運行速度和資源利用率。優(yōu)化性能線性結(jié)構(gòu)02線性表概念包括順序存儲和鏈?zhǔn)酱鎯?,各有?yōu)缺點。存儲結(jié)構(gòu)線性表是有序數(shù)據(jù)元素的集合,具有前驅(qū)后繼關(guān)系。定義與特點棧和隊列棧的定義后進(jìn)先出數(shù)據(jù)結(jié)構(gòu)隊列的定義先進(jìn)先出數(shù)據(jù)結(jié)構(gòu)串的處理01模式匹配在串中查找子串或模式,如KMP算法等。02串的編輯操作包括插入、刪除、替換字符等操作,用于文本編輯和比對。非線性結(jié)構(gòu)03樹的概念和性質(zhì)樹定義非線性數(shù)據(jù)結(jié)構(gòu),節(jié)點有層次關(guān)系性質(zhì)特點具有根節(jié)點,子節(jié)點唯一父節(jié)點圖的表示方法用二維數(shù)組表示頂點間關(guān)系。鄰接矩陣01用鏈表表示每個頂點的鄰接頂點。鄰接表02集合與多集01集合概念元素不重復(fù)的數(shù)據(jù)結(jié)構(gòu)02多集特點元素可重復(fù)的數(shù)據(jù)集合算法基礎(chǔ)04算法的定義算法是解決問題的步驟或方法。01算法概念包括有限性、確定性等。02特性概述算法的特性每個步驟清晰明確,無歧義。明確性在有限步驟內(nèi)能執(zhí)行完畢。有限性算法效率分析評估算法執(zhí)行時間與輸入規(guī)模的關(guān)系。時間復(fù)雜度分析算法在運行過程中臨時占用存儲空間的大小??臻g復(fù)雜度排序算法05排序算法概述定義與分類效率評估01排序算法是對數(shù)據(jù)元素排序的方法,分為比較排序與非比較排序。02通過時間復(fù)雜度和空間復(fù)雜度評估排序算法的效率。常見排序方法01通過相鄰元素比較交換,逐步將最大或最小元素移到序列一端。02選取基準(zhǔn)元素,通過一趟排序?qū)⑿蛄蟹譃閮刹糠?,遞歸排序。冒泡排序快速排序排序算法比較比較各排序算法的時間消耗,評估其效率。時間復(fù)雜度探討排序算法是否保持相等元素相對順序。穩(wěn)定性分析排序算法所需輔助空間,衡量內(nèi)存使用??臻g復(fù)雜度010203查找算法06查找算法概述闡述查找算法在數(shù)據(jù)處理、信息檢索等領(lǐng)域的應(yīng)用實例。應(yīng)用場景介紹查找算法的基本概念及主要分類。定義與分類靜態(tài)查找表按線性順序逐一比較,直到找到目標(biāo)元素或查找完所有元素。順序查找01在有序表中,每次取中間元素比較,縮小查找范圍,直到找到目標(biāo)元素。二分查找02動態(tài)查找表01二叉搜索樹利用二叉樹結(jié)構(gòu)實現(xiàn)高效查找
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 廣東小學(xué)課題申報書要求
- 手術(shù)安全核查制度試題(附答案)
- 2025年中學(xué)教師資格考試《綜合素質(zhì)》教學(xué)反思與總結(jié)能力測試試題卷(含答案)
- 2025年寧夏安全員《A證》考試題庫及答案
- 間皮瘤表觀遺傳學(xué)診斷方法研究-洞察及研究
- 納米顆粒在焊接界面的作用與影響-洞察及研究
- 小學(xué)體育教學(xué)中體能訓(xùn)練與健康教育融合實踐課題報告教學(xué)研究課題報告
- 人工智能在投資決策中的應(yīng)用
- 企業(yè)知識生態(tài)系統(tǒng)-洞察及研究
- 高中物理電磁感應(yīng)現(xiàn)象的虛擬實驗平臺開發(fā)研究教學(xué)研究課題報告
- 2026年榆能集團(tuán)陜西精益化工有限公司招聘備考題庫完整答案詳解
- 2026廣東省環(huán)境科學(xué)研究院招聘專業(yè)技術(shù)人員16人筆試參考題庫及答案解析
- 邊坡支護(hù)安全監(jiān)理實施細(xì)則范文(3篇)
- 6.1.3化學(xué)反應(yīng)速率與反應(yīng)限度(第3課時 化學(xué)反應(yīng)的限度) 課件 高中化學(xué)新蘇教版必修第二冊(2022-2023學(xué)年)
- 北京市西城區(qū)第8中學(xué)2026屆生物高二上期末學(xué)業(yè)質(zhì)量監(jiān)測模擬試題含解析
- 廣東高中高考英語聽說考試故事速記復(fù)述技巧
- GB/T 32065.5-2015海洋儀器環(huán)境試驗方法第5部分:高溫貯存試驗
- GB/T 20033.3-2006人工材料體育場地使用要求及檢驗方法第3部分:足球場地人造草面層
- 2023年牡丹江市林業(yè)系統(tǒng)事業(yè)單位招聘筆試模擬試題及答案解析
- 數(shù)字電子技術(shù)說課課件
- 天然氣加氣站安全事故的案例培訓(xùn)課件
評論
0/150
提交評論